WebSphere MQ基础教程:原理、架构与应用开发

需积分: 0 0 下载量 19 浏览量 更新于2024-11-02 收藏 2.16MB DOC 举报
"Websphere MQ入门教程,全书涵盖WebSphere MQ原理、体系结构、系统管理和应用开发,旨在帮助初学者理解并掌握这一消息中间件的使用。" Websphere MQ是IBM提供的一种高性能、高可靠性的消息中间件,它允许不同系统间的异构应用程序通过消息传递进行通信,从而实现数据的可靠传输。本教程分为三个部分,详细介绍了WebSphere MQ的基础知识和实践操作。 第一部分主要讲解WebSphere MQ的原理和体系结构。在第一章中,介绍了中间件的基本概念,包括其优点,如提高系统集成性、降低复杂性等,并对比了三种通信技术:TCP/IP、RPC和消息队列。接着,深入阐述了WebSphere MQ的工作原理,强调其统一接口、处理时间不敏感性和分布式处理能力。本部分还列举了WebSphere MQ的关键特性,如独立于平台的API,以及它如何提供健壮的中间件服务。 第二章详细解析了WebSphere MQ的体系结构,包括基本概念如消息、队列、队列管理器、通道、进程、群集、名称列表、认证信息对象等。其中,队列管理器是核心组件,负责管理消息的存储和路由。此外,章节还介绍了触发机制,使得消息可以在满足特定条件时自动触发应用执行,以及队列管理器群集的概念,用于实现高可用性和负载均衡。 第二部分侧重于WebSphere MQ的系统管理,包括系统的安装、配置和维护。第三章详细描述了安装过程,从规划硬件和软件需求到实际安装步骤,再到安装验证,确保读者能够正确部署WebSphere MQ环境。第四章则讨论了如何使用命令行工具来管理本地和远程的WebSphere MQ系统,这对于日常运维至关重要。 第三部分,即WebSphere MQ的应用开发,虽然没有给出具体内容,但可以预见将涵盖编程接口MQI(Message Queue Interface)的使用,以及编写和调试WebSphere MQ应用程序的方法和示例。 通过本教程,读者将能够全面了解WebSphere MQ,从理论基础到实际操作,为构建基于消息的分布式系统打下坚实基础。学习过程中,读者可以结合章节小结和练习题,巩固理解,提升技能。